探究我的SVN服务器不显示IP地址的原因
- 行业动态
- 2024-09-15
- 1
如果您的SVN服务器上没有IP地址,可能是因为网络配置问题或者防火墙设置阻止了IP地址的分配。请检查您的网络配置和防火墙设置,确保它们允许IP地址的分配。如果问题仍然存在,请联系您的网络管理员或服务提供商寻求帮助。
SVN服务器没有IP的问题可能会给用户带来不小的困扰,影响日常的版本控制工作,下面将详细介绍可能导致SVN服务器没有IP的原因:
1、配置错误
检查IP地址设置:需要确认SVN服务器是否被正确分配并配置了IP地址,在配置过程中,任何疏忽都可能导致IP地址未能正确设置。
端口号正确性:除了IP地址,还需要确保正确的端口号被配置,以确保SVN服务能够正常监听请求。
2、协议与域名使用
协议对域名的依赖:SVN服务器可能基于HTTP、HTTPS或SVN协议工作,这些协议通常使用域名而不是直接的IP地址来定位服务器。
域名解析问题:若SVN服务器使用的是域名,需要确保域名能够正确解析到相应的IP地址,否则可能导致看似“没有IP”的情况。
3、IP地址变更
服务器迁移:如果SVN服务器因为迁移等原因更改了IP地址,需要相应更新服务器配置以反映这一变化。
更新working copy:在IP地址变更后,已有的working copy需要通过svn switch命令更新到新的服务器地址,以确保可以继续正常工作。
4、服务器名称与电脑名称
修改服务器名称:在某些情况下,可能需要将SVN服务器的名称修改为电脑的名称,以确保服务器可以被正确识别和访问。
电脑名称识别:确保在配置中使用的电脑名称是正确的,错误的电脑名称可能会导致无法正确访问SVN服务器。
5、网络连接问题
检查网络连通性:确保SVN服务器所在的设备与客户端之间的网络连接是正常的,任何网络故障都可能导致无法获取IP地址。
防火墙设置:检查是否有防火墙或其他安全软件设置阻止了对SVN服务器的访问,这可能影响到IP地址的获取。
6、子网和路由配置
子网划分:在大型网络中,不正确的子网划分可能导致SVN服务器的IP地址在特定区域不可见。
路由设置:错误的路由配置也可能导致无法从特定网络段访问到SVN服务器的IP地址。
7、DNS设置问题
DNS服务器配置:如果使用域名访问SVN服务器,错误的DNS设置可能导致域名无法解析为正确的IP地址。
本地hosts文件:可以通过修改本地hosts文件的方式,手动指定域名与IP地址的映射关系,以解决访问问题。
8、版本兼容性
客户端与服务器版本:确保使用的SVN客户端与服务器版本兼容,避免因版本差异导致的IP地址识别问题。
SVN服务器没有IP的问题可能由多种因素导致,包括配置错误、协议依赖、IP地址变更、网络连接问题等,用户在遇到此类问题时,应从上述各个角度进行排查和调整,对于SVN服务器的管理和使用,建议采取一些预防措施,如定期检查和备份服务器配置、保持软件版本的更新、确保网络安全设置不会干扰SVN服务的正常运行,通过这些方法,可以有效避免和解决SVN服务器没有IP的问题,确保版本控制系统的稳定运行。
本站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本站,有问题联系侵删!
本文链接:http://www.xixizhuji.com/fuzhu/79424.html